Drama Presentation 
Rubric Code: KX5W7W
Ready to use
Public Rubric
Subject: Arts and Design  
Type: Presentation  
Grade Levels: 9-12

Powered by iRubric Drama Presentation
  Poor

1 pts

Fair

2 pts

Good

3 pts

Proficient

4 pts

Voice & Diction

Poor

My voice was expressiveless with no variation in pitch, volume, pause & rate and emphasis. None of my words could be clearly understood.
Fair

My voice was not very expressive not using variation in pitch, volume, pause & rate and emphasis. My words could not be clearly understood.
Good

My voice was mostly expressive using variation in pitch, volume, pause & rate and emphasis. My words could be understood most of the time.
Proficient

My voice was expressive using variation in pitch, volume, pause & rate and emphasis. My words could be clearly understood.
Gestures & Movement

Poor

My gestures and movement were not at all appropriate for the my character. Often they drew attention away from the other actors.
Fair

My gestures and movement were not very appropriate for the my character. Sometimes they drew attention away from the other actors.
Good

My gestures and movement were mostly appropriate for the my character. For the most part, they did not draw attention away from the other actors.
Proficient

My gestures and movement were appropriate for the my character. They did not draw attention away from the other actors.
Use ot Props

Poor

I did not have most of my props. The ones I had were in poor condition or inappropriate.
Fair

Some of my props were appropriate to the scene and my character. They were in fair condition.
Good

Most of my props were appropriate to the scene and my character. They were in good condition.
Proficient

My props were appropriate to the scene and my character. They were in excellent condition.
Creativity

Poor

I my character was not developed. I did not understand the theme and situation of the play. I remained "out of character" throughout my performance.
Fair

I my character was somewhat developed. I partially understood the theme and situation of the play. I remained "in character" throughout some of my performance.
Good

I my character was almost developed. I understood most of the theme and situation of the play. I remained "in character" throughout most of my performance.
Proficient

I my character was well developed. I understand the theme and situation of the play. I remained consistantly "in character" throughout my performance.
Professionalism

Poor

I had half (50%) of my lines and blocking memorized by the deadline. I am seldom on time for class/rehearsals and have none of materials needed (scripts, pencil, props, etc.).
Fair

I had some (60%) of my lines and blocking memorized by the deadline. I am usually on time for class/rehearsals and have all materials needed (scripts, pencil, props, etc.).
Good

I had most (90%) of my lines and blocking memorized by the deadline. I am often on time for class/rehearsals and have all materials needed (scripts, pencil, props, etc.).
Proficient

I had all of my lines and blocking memorized by the deadline. I am always on time for class/rehearsals and have all materials needed (scripts, pencil, props, etc.).
